Did a little R&R trip down to E Tenn at Watts Bar Reservoir, this past weekend. Took my buddy & site member Paul with me, and stayed at the Arrowhead Marina/Resort. Great place to stay & good people to do business with !!
Water temps were still warm ... generally around 67deg surface temps.
Sunny skies & calm North to Northeast winds prevailed.
Shad schools were all over ... mostly running from 5-10ft deep.
Crappie, on the other hand, were not that shallow
Dock shooting only gave us one 11" White Crappie.
We were forced to "hunt" for submerged trees that the tops extended into water depths of 25' or more. We found two such trees, on two different days, and managed to pull around 15 Crappie (total) from those trees. Most were Blacknose, and ranged in the 12-13" lengths.

Caught most all of these fish on jigs/plastics ... 1/16oz weedless jigheads with yellow/char tubes (Paul's choice) & popsickle CrappiePro Slugs (my choice). Cast/countdown method & Vertical Casting method worked equally well. Seemed like it would mostly go something like this :
cast - countdown - retrieve - limb - "thump" - hookset - net - livewell
